Regarding other prescribed medications, researchers behind a 2020 study found that people experiencing withdrawal from antidepressants may experience lasting, severe PAWS symptoms. The symptoms lasted from 6 months to more than 23 years, with a median of about 6.5 years.

The symptoms of PAWS can vary post-acute withdrawal syndrome significantly depending on the substance used, duration of use, and individual factors. However, certain patterns are commonly observed across different substances.
Stress Management Techniques
A stable daily routine can provide structure and https://launchwebs.co.uk/what-is-sober-curious-meaning-benefits-how-to-2/ reduce the unpredictability of symptoms. This can include regular meal times, exercise, and scheduled relaxation periods. Setting achievable goals and gradually incorporating them into the routine can also help build a sense of accomplishment.
